Output 8a00068c157a8fde31e07f7923c62990914d8047e8d5fc50ddcc275a04eac3ac:0

value
63301519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850ddb5bcf6e971fa94b6148d7203e8bbc76e66b OP_EQUAL
address
3DpYPrDaRSDfGrH8kNzduqeDrxDfdbwkNC
transaction
8a00068c157a8fde31e07f7923c62990914d8047e8d5fc50ddcc275a04eac3ac
spent
true